Martha J Chesnutt, MD

According to 2025 Medicare claims, Martha Chesnutt, MD (NPI: 1659365690) practices internal medicine in the Rocky Mount, NC market, with the plurality of this provider's patient population coming from Nash, NC. This provider's primary affiliated billing organization is BOICE-WILLIS CLINIC PA (NPI: 1699722389; TIN: 561025986) and primary practice location at 27804-8467. Chesnutt is affiliated with the The Accountable Care Organization, Ltd. (ACO ID: A2098), participating under the MSSP model.

Chesnutt's data goes back to 2015 and runs through 2024. For example, in 2024, this provider had 521 traditional Medicare patients, billed 3,117 HCPCS/CPT codes, and received $168,379 in Medicare payments. The top billing code was G0439 (Annual wellness visit, includes a personalized prevention plan of service (pps), subsequent visit). Part D data shows 5,478 prescription claims across 402 beneficiaries totaling $329,756 in drug costs, led by Eliquis (Apixaban). DME data shows 104 claims. No Open Payments records. Over the past 10 years, this provider's Medicare Part B carrier billing has moved up and down with repeated peaks and valleys, starting at $174,536 and ending at $168,379. Concurrently, Part D prescription costs have declined steadily, from $584,909 to $329,756. In contrast, DME billing represents a smaller volume and moved up and down with repeated peaks and valleys, starting at $13,886 and ending at $7,897.
